The Hidden Dimension argues that culture is a hidden dimension that shapes societies and organizations in profound yet often unnoticed ways. It explores how national cultures can influence attitudes toward technology, work habits, and relationships. The author contends that understanding these cultural differences is key to improving communication and productivity between groups from various cultures.
